CPS Technologies Announces Second Quarter 2025 Financial Results
CPS TechnologiesCPS Technologies(US:CPSH) GlobeNewswire News Room·2025-07-30 20:01

Core Insights - CPS Technologies Corporation reported a return to profitability with positive net income and record revenue in the second quarter of fiscal 2025, driven by higher production rates and increased shipments [1][2][3] - The company expects strong revenue in the second half of the year, with an emphasis on improving gross margins and overall profitability [1][2] - CPS secured its first order for AlMax™ material, showcasing its innovative technologies and effective manufacturing capabilities [1][6] Financial Performance - Revenue for the second quarter was $8.1 million, up from $5.0 million in the same period last year, reflecting a 62% increase [2][6] - Gross profit was $1.3 million, representing a gross margin of 16.5%, compared to a gross loss of $0.2 million in the prior-year period [2][6] - Operating profit was $0.1 million, a significant improvement from an operating loss of $(1.3) million in the previous year [3][6] Earnings and Share Performance - Reported net income was $0.1 million, or $0.01 per diluted share, compared to a net loss of $(0.9) million, or $(0.07) per diluted share, in the same quarter last year [3][9] - The weighted average number of diluted common shares outstanding was 14,577,433 [9] Product and Market Development - CPS announced its fourth Small Business Innovation Research (SBIR) contract of the year, focusing on reducing the weight of the Amphibious Combat Vehicle for the U.S. Marine Corps [6] - The company continues to expand its product catalog and has demonstrated robust demand for its offerings [1][6] Company Overview - CPS is a leader in high-performance materials solutions, addressing critical needs in various applications, including electric vehicles, wind turbines, and defense [5] - The company is committed to innovation and supporting the transition to clean energy [5]
